The 1999-built Norwegian Sky cruise ship is NCL's first Sky-class vessel, with sisterships Norwegian Sun and Costa Victoria (1996-2021).

The vessel (IMO number 9128532) is currently Bahamas- flagged (MMSI 308865000) and registered in Nassau .

History - construction and ownership

Norwegian Cruise Line (NCL) is a subsidiary company of the shipping corporation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d (NCLH). NCL was founded in 1966, headquartered in Miami (Florida USA) and publicly traded (NASDAQ) company listed on NYSE ( NYC ). NCLH's major shareholders are the corporations Apollo Global Management (American), Genting Group (Malaysian) and TPG Capital (American). In 2017, the brand NCL had a worldwide cruise market share 8,7% (passengers) and 8,4% (revenue). NCLH (shipowner) owns the brands NCL , Oceania and RSSC-Regent .

NCL Norwegian Sky cruise ship

The 2000-passenger ship Norwegian Sky started operations on August 9, 1999, with the inaugural 4-day roundtrip from Dover to Norway's Fjords. The cruise ship was refurbished and changed her name several times. She is designed in beautiful tropical colors. NCL Sky was originally ordered by Costa Cruises as Costa Olympia, but later the company refused the vessel. In the period 2004-2008, it was operated by NCL America and sailed as "Pride of Aloha" - USA- flagged , but owned by GHK-Genting Hong Kong.

Decks and Cabins

Norwegian Sky staterooms (1002 total, in 27 grades) include 15x Suites, 245x Balcony, 319x Oceanview and 423x Inside cabins. Most staterooms are sized 120-150 ft2 (11-14 m2). The largest accommodations are the Owners Suites (350 ft2 / 32 m2, with terrace sized 300 ft2 / 28 m2).

The boat has 12 decks , of which 9 are passenger-accessible and 7 with cabins.

Itineraries

Norwegian Sky itinerary program is based on 3- and 4-day short Bahamas cruises from Miami Florida . Feature port destinations include Nassau and NCL's private island Great Stirrup Cay Bahamas .

  • NCL Sky's 2017-2018 itinerary program offered 4-night voyages from Miami to Cuba with Havana overnights (May through December 2017). The itinerary also visited Great Stirrup Cay.
  • With Norwegian Sky, NCL's first-ever ship call at Havana was on May 2, 2017 (overnight). NCL Sky's Cuban cruise prices started from USD 700 per person (inclusive of unlimited drinks).
  • In 2018, NCL expanded the Cuba program to a total of 63 itineraries, most of which with Havana overnights. The season (4-day Miami roundtrips) started on March 26, 2018. The number of previously scheduled 2018 NCL Cuba cruises was 30 (through December 2017).
  • NCL's Cuban cruise program was based on two Florida-homeported liners - Norwegian Sky (from Miami) and Norwegian Sun (from Port Canaveral). Following the US Gov's June 2019-issued ban on group travel to Cuba from the USA, NCL revised all its scheduled itineraries visiting Cuban seaports. All planned departures beyond September 2 (2019) were auto-canceled. Cuba-visiting itineraries prior to September 2nd were modified to exclude Havana and visit other Caribbean ports - including in Bahamas ( Great Stirrup Cay Island , Freeport , Nassau ) and Florida ( Key West Florida ).

Due to the Coronavirus crisis, the NCL Sky ship was paused for 2 years (March 2020 thru 2022), restarting on March 2nd with 3-4-5-day roundtrips from Miami to the Bahamas.

The ship's 2023 schedule (September-October) has a mini-season based on homeporting in Baltimore MD (at Cruise Maryland Terminal). The program includes 10-11-day Canada and New England itineraries between USA and Canada ( Baltimore and Quebec City ) visiting Halifax, Bar Harbor, Shelburne Harbour, Oak Bluffs Marina, Baie-Comeau.

Norwegian Sky Wiki

Norwegian Sky is of the Sky-Class NCL liners, with sisterships NCL Sun and Costa Victoria . Vessel's construction started as an order from Costa Cruises (Costa Crociere) placed to Bremer Vulkan AG (1893-1997 / bankruptcy, a shipbuilding company, Bremen Germany) as the 2nd in a pair of Costa newbuilds . The ship name in this order was "Costa Olympia". Due to Vulkan's financial problems at that time, Costa Olympia's construction was suspended with only ~1/3 of the vessel completed. On October 5, 1996, Olympia's incomplete hull was floated out from drydock.

Costa didn't pay for the incomplete vessel, so it was laid up until December 1997, when NCL purchased it and re-designed it as "Norwegian Sky" (using the services of Tillberg Design, Sweden). NCL Sky's construction was continued at Lloyd Werft's shipyard in Bremerhaven (another major German shipbuilder) to where the hull was towed on March 8, 1998. The ship was officially acquired by NCL on July 29, 1999. The Inaugural Cruise (Maiden Voyage) was on August 9, 1999 (Norway Fjords from Dover England ), also featuring 20th century's last total solar eclipse. Ship's inaugural USA season started from homeport Boston MA to Canada-New England (Sept 18, 1999) and from homeport Miami FL to Caribbean (Nov 14, 1999).

Ship's godparents were its entire crew. The liner was christened during the August 9 cruise (1999). As "Norwegian Sky", it was operated between 1999-2004. On July 4, 2004, the vessel left drydock in San Francisco CA as "Pride of Aloha".

Pride of Aloha ship's godmother was Margaret Awamura Inouye - wife of US Senator Daniel Inouye (Hawaii). The liner operated exclusively Hawaiian Islands cruises in 2004-2008. During that period, it was US- flagged and operated by the "NCL America" brand (NCLH's subsidiary). In NCL America's fleet, Aloha was joined in 2006 by the sistership Pride of Hawaii (now Norwegian Jade).

NCL originally planned to sell the vessel to Star Cruises (GHK-owned company). Later a decision was announced to sell it to Pullmantur ( RCL-Royal Caribbean brand in Spain). In May 2008, NCL announced that the ship stays in the fleet. After being re-flagged to the Bahamas, it re-entered service as "Norwegian Sky". The second "Maiden Voyage" (now as NCL Sky) was on July 14, 2008.

In early-2009, NCL Sky was sold to GHK (Genting Hong Kong). NCL operated the vessel under one-year charter, with the options to extend the charter, but also to buy the vessel during the charter period. On June 1, 2012, NCL exercised the option and bought the ship for ~USD 260 million.

Norwegian Sky was the first ever passenger liner with an Internet Cafe (via satellite connection). At that time, this venue had 9 PC terminals for going online at sea. List of services (available 24 hours a day, at US$20 per hour or 33 cents per min) included emailing, PC games, photo imaging, Microsoft Word, Excel and PowerPoint apps, printing. Sky is also NCL's first ever ship equipped with "Bridge Cam" (digital camera offering 24-hour real-time views from the bow / updated every 15 min).

Since January 2016, all NCL Sky passengers leaving from Miami FL enjoy free unlimited drinks (including alcohol - beers, wines, premium spirits). All onboard beverages (normally priced up to USD 11) are included in cruise fares. The list includes cocktails, premium spirits, bottled beers, draft beers, wines by the glass. Passengers 3 to 20 years of age also enjoy unlimited drinks - soda and juices. Being the oldest in the fleet, Norwegian Sky operates on short cruises (3- and 4-day Miami roundtrips) to the Bahamas - the whole year-round. The all-inclusive cruising experience includes unlimited beverages also on NCL's private island Great Stirrup Cay , which is paired in the itinerary together with Nassau .

In 2017, Sky became NCL's first liner with itineraries visiting Cuba. The Cuban cruise program (May through December 2017) offered 4-day roundtrips from PortMiami (Monday departures) with Havana overnights. The itinerary also visited NCL's private island Great Stirrup Cay . Bookings on NCL's Cuban cruises opened on February 21, 2017.

The next table shows NCL Sky's first cruise to Cuba (itinerary May 1-5) with the port times.

The 4-day roundtrip Miami cruise prices started from USD 950 pp (double occupancy inside cabin rates).

During drydock refurbishment 2017, the ship was retrofitted with new "scrubbers" (exhaust gas cleaning systems). The new scrubber technology reduces the equivalent of approx 1500 tons of the poisonous gas Sulfur Oxide. Norwegian Cruise Line was the first cruise company retrofitting with a scrubber hybrid system vessels while in service. The new in-line scrubbers (5 units) are lightweight and able to operate in a dry mode, as well as in open and closed loops.

During drydock 2019 (Jan 25 - Feb 6, done at Grand Bahama Shipyard in Freeport Bahamas ), renovations were made to the pool deck and some lounges, also the Starbucks Coffee Bar was added.

Drydock 2022 (Jan 5 - Feb 7) was conducted in France, at Damen Shiprepair Brest .

The “All Inclusive”

The Sky is the only mass market ship to offer all-inclusive alcohol on every sailing. While most lines now have alcohol beverage packages you can purchase, the Sky’s is built into the price of your sailing. This was a great value for me and it is a major selling point for me to return to the Sky. While I expected the bars to be crazy and packed all the time, this was not the case. Instead of the usual bartenders working up and down the bar, the Sky has instituted queues or lines to ensure everyone gets served in order. They also do not require the swiping of cruise cards or signing of receipts since everyone on the ship has drinks included, this helps the line go really fast. It was a much better process than I anticipated.

All Inclusive Package

The Norwegian Sky offers all guests the beverage package which included numerous premium beverage options, beer options, a variety of wines and sodas and juices. There were some items that were not included; however, the list of covered beverages was quiet extensive and you could get everything from fancy martinis to various mixed drinks.

Bars and Pool Deck

Norwegian Sky

The bars on the pool deck were busy throughout the cruise and there were lines setup to help speed the process. The bars were setup with four pre-mixed drinks in large containers as well as four frozen drink machines. The bartenders were on hand to make all the other drinks fresh when ordered. We sampled some of the pre-mixed drinks and found them to be very sweet. In addition, the pre-made frozen drinks in the daiquiri machines also were very sweet. All of the drinks we ordered that were made fresh were poured strong with premium brands and they were presented neatly. The majority of the bars served the drinks in plastic cups; however, a few of the bars and lounges offered glassware.

On a recent NCL Cruise, the bars had some drinks pre-made as well but it seemed to be mostly the frozen ones as opposed to all those containers as I saw during the cruise in the past.

We felt that all the bar colleagues that we interacted with were friendly and polite and they seemed happy to assist us. We were surprised that no-upselling was noted. Typically, on cruises the bar staff actively promote the souvenir glasses and beverages. We did not see this happening at all. Although the souvenir glass drinks were promoted in the ships programs, they were not being emphasized by the bartenders. In addition, the gratuity was included in the all-inclusive program as well as the daily service charge, so tips were not required or expected at the bars.

Great Stirrup Cay 

The final port was Great Stirrup Cay. This was Norwegians Private Island. The port is accessed by tender or small boats that come bring passengers from the ship to shore.

Norwegian Sky

When my wife and I were ready to depart the ship, we proceeded to one of the lounges where we were told we would need tender tickets. When we arrived there was a sign saying that no tickets were required to we proceeded to the lower level for boarding the tender. When we arrived there was a line of about 30-40 other guests. We waited for about 10 minutes before being asked to board the tender. The tender was large and it could seat 250+ guests. The boat was open air so we selected a seat on the top deck and watched the ship and the ocean while we waited for the boat to depart.

Norwegian Sky

The tender departed after about 20 minutes. There was a short ride to the island. During the voyage we were given excellent views of the ship.

Norwegian Sky

Upon arrival at the island there was a short wait while everyone departed the tender.

Once we entered the island we found it to be quite large. There were three separate large beach areas, four bars, a main restaurant that featured an Island BBQ as well as a lagoon. Plenty of beach chairs were available throughout the island.

Norwegian Sky

Norwegian sells private cabanas on the island. The cabanas looked nice; however, it seemed unnecessary as the island was so spread out.

Norwegian Sky

Norwegian extended the all-inclusive drink option to the island as all the food and beverages are served by staff from the ship. The bars were setup similar to the ones on the ship and they appeared to offer all of the same drinks including the premium brands.

Activities for purchase were available on the island including snorkeling, scuba diving, floating devices as well as parasailing and a few other tours. The cruise staff also hosted games and activities on the beach including a tug of war contest.

Norwegian Sky

My wife and I relaxed on the beach. I ended up staying on the island a little longer than my wife so I walked around the island and did some more exploring before relaxing for a little longer.

Norwegian Sky

I had lunch at the Beach BBQ and found a variety of items offered included, sandwiches, pizza, burgers, jerk chicken, hot dogs and salads as well as desserts and fruit. The food was all signed and it all looked appetizing.

Norwegian Sky

When I was ready to depart the island I proceeded to the tender area and I waited in a small line. While I was in line, I was given a cool towel by the cruise staff to relax before I was invited to board the tender. The tender filled up quickly and it departed within 20 minutes of me joining the line.

It was a short journey back and it again offered great views of the island and the ship.

Princess and Royal Caribbean also have private islands near Norwegian’s so while we were in port, you could see a Princess and Royal Caribbean ship anchored nearby.

Now Royal Caribbean has a dock so the ships do not anchor; however, Princess stills uses tenders for their ships as well as the Carnival ones that visit Princess Cays.

We went on a trip to the Bahamas through Norwegian Cruise Line on the Norwegian Sky. It was a 4-night cruise departing from Miami . This is (as far as I’m aware) the only ship on their fleet, which is totally all inclusive (except for the specialty restaurants).

What I mean by this is that every person on board automatically gets the ‘ NCL Premium   beverage package ‘. This entitles you all drinks on board up to an $ 15 USD value. This gives you access to a wide range of drinks. While technically this doesn’t include ALL drinks, there wasn’t any drinks that we ordered that came above the $15 limit.
